Basic Concepts of a Cylinder Head

A cylinder head is a key part of an internal combustion engine, sealing the top of the cylinder and allowing for the intake and exhaust of gases. It houses the valves, spark plugs (in gasoline engines), and fuel injectors (in diesel engines), and plays a role in the compression and combustion of the air-fuel mixture. The cylinder head interacts closely with the engine block, pistons, and other components to facilitate the engine’s operation 1.

Role of Part 3967931 Cylinder Head in Engine Systems

The part 3967931 Cylinder Head is an integral component in the operation of various engine systems. It serves as the upper part of the engine block and houses several essential elements that contribute to the engine’s performance and efficiency.

Combustion Chamber

The cylinder head encloses the combustion chamber, where fuel is ignited. This chamber is designed to optimize the combustion process, ensuring that the air-fuel mixture burns efficiently to produce maximum power with minimal emissions.

Valves and Valve Seats

Integral to the cylinder head are the intake and exhaust valves. These valves open and close to allow the intake of air-fuel mixture and the expulsion of exhaust gases. The valve seats, which are part of the cylinder head, provide a seal when the valves are closed, preventing any leakage that could reduce engine efficiency.

Spark Plugs

In gasoline engines, the cylinder head includes ports for spark plugs. These plugs ignite the air-fuel mixture at the precise moment to ensure efficient combustion. The placement and design of these ports within the cylinder head are critical for optimal spark delivery.

Fuel Injectors

In fuel-injected engines, the cylinder head may house the fuel injectors. These injectors spray a fine mist of fuel into the combustion chamber, mixing with the incoming air for combustion. The design of the cylinder head affects the spray pattern and distribution of fuel, influencing combustion efficiency.

Cooling System Integration

The cylinder head is also a key component in the engine’s cooling system. It contains passages for coolant to flow around the combustion chambers and valves, dissipating heat generated during operation. Effective cooling is essential for maintaining engine temperature within optimal ranges.

Emission Control

Modern cylinder heads are designed with features that help reduce emissions. This includes precise valve timing and the integration of components like Exhaust Gas Recirculation (EGR) ports, which recirculate a portion of the exhaust gases back into the combustion chamber to reduce nitrogen oxides.

Structural Role

Beyond its functional roles, the cylinder head also plays a structural part in the engine. It provides a sealing surface against the engine block, ensuring that the pressures generated during combustion are contained within the engine.
